Kitchen

  • Items you use regularly should be in easy reach between hip and eye level. This avoids the need to stoop or stretch.
  • Hot dishes should be easily moved from the oven /cooker onto the working surface (bench-top) or onto the table.
  • All extension cords and appliance cords should be secured and not lying around in the room.
  • Tables and worktops should be sturdy enough to support your weight if you lean on them.
  • The floors should be non-slip (if you spill liquid, wipe it up immediately).


  • You may find a mobile trolley handy for transporting food and dishes more safely from the kitchen into the dining room.
